The StarCraft II batches continue

Again the hard working Karune from Blizzard Entertainments has answered a couple questions about StarCraft II. Just like last time it is questions from some of the fansites out there being answered - enjoy!



Are the Ultralisks making a return in SC2? - (starcraft2forum.org)
- The Ultralisk figures heavily in our current plans, but as with everything else relating to units and balance, this is subject to change.

Will there be in game voice chat supported in SC2? - (teamliquid.net)
- Yes, there are plans to implement VoIP into Battle.net, but details beyond that are yet to be announced.

What are the system requirements? - (Starcraft-Source.com)
- We are still optimizing the game and do not have minimum system requirements yet. Nonetheless, StarCraft II will require pixel shader 2.0 and at least 128mb of dedicated video RAM.

Will we be seeing any hybrid units in StarCraft II? - (starcraft.org)
- We are planning to explore the mysteries surrounding the Xel'naga for the single player campaign. In the campaign you will encounter several unique units that would not otherwise be seen in multiplayer. At this time, you'll just have to wait and see.

Does the Thor burn out like Terran buildings if it is damaged? - (starcraft2.4players.de)
- No, the Thor does not burn down like the Terran buildings. It will be like the other Terran vehicles, which are able to be repaired by the scv.
